Multiple Airports In West Ky. To Receive More Than $4 Million From FAA

Public Domain
/
Wikimedia Commons

Multiple airports in Kentucky will receive $27.3 million in federal grants to fund “construction and rehabilitation projects” as announced by U.S. Transportation Secretary Elaine Chao on Tuesday.

According to a release from the Federal Aviation Administration, more than $4.1 million will be directed to airports in west Kentucky including the Jackson Purchase region.

The Barkley Regional Airport in Paducah will receive more than $2.2 million to construct a terminal building. The Fulton Airport was granted $216,000 to remove obstructions. Lake Barkley State Park near Cadiz will receive $150,000 to improve the runway safety area. 

More than $1 million dollars will go to the Owensboro-Daviess County Regional Airport and Kyle-Oakley Field.




The following airports will receive a grant:

  • Lake Barkley State Park, Cadiz- $150,000 – grant funds will be used to improve the Runway 02/20 safety area.

  • Bowman Field, Louisville–$562,500 – grant funds will be used to install airfield guidance signs.

  • Cincinnati/Northern Kentucky International–$5,538,862 – grant funds will be used to rehabilitate Taxiway S.

  • Fulton Airport–$216,000 – grant funds will be used to remove obstructions.

  • Rough River State Park, Falls of Rough- $300,000 – grant funds will be used to rehabilitate an aircraft parking area.

  • London-Corbin Airport-Magee Field- $1,403,934–grant funds to rehabilitate Runway 06/24.

  • Louisville Muhammad Ali International–$15,026,036– grant funds will be used to rehabilitate Taxiway C and reconstruct Taxiway G, rehabilitate lights for Runway 17R/35L and Runway 17L/35R and provide noise mitigation measures for public buildings and residences and acquire land for noise compatibility.

  • Kyle-Oakley Field, Murray -$359,500 – grant funds acquire land for a protection zone for Runway 05.

  • Owensboro-Daviess County Regional- $1,152,240 – grant funds will be used to rehabilitate Runway 18/36, Taxiway C and D and an aircraft parking area.

  • Barkley Regional, Paducah- $2,296,605 – grant funds will be used to construct a terminal building.

  • Lake Cumberland Regional, Somerset– $212,000–grant funds will be used to acquire snow removal equipment.

  • Williamsburg-Whitley County, Williamsburg- $63,869 – grant funds will be used to improve airport drainage.
